Solar-powered cars are equipped with photovoltaic cells that convert sunlight into electricity. These cells are typically integrated into the vehicle's body or roof, allowing them to capture sunlight while on the move or parked. The electricity generated is stored in a battery, which can then be used to power the car's electric motor.
